<div dir="ltr"><div class="gmail_extra"><br><div class="gmail_quote">On Mon, Oct 14, 2013 at 9:35 AM, Alex Barth <span dir="ltr"><<a href="mailto:alex@mapbox.com" target="_blank">alex@mapbox.com</a>></span> wrote:<br>

<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div>## Option 2: Always keep address points separate</div><div><br></div><div>

In this case we never merge addresses to building polygons, instead always keep them as separate entities.</div><div><br></div><div>Pros:</div><div><br></div><div>a) this is the NYC GIS way, making it nicer for GIS folks to use OSM</div>



<div>b) this is the generally applicable method. No matter whether we have one or multiple addresses you can expect to find a separate node carrying address information.</div><div>c) retains useful information</div><div>


<br>
</div><div>Cons:</div><div><br></div><div>a) Diverges (but does not violate [1]) common OSM practice</div><div><br></div><div>Note: it has been suggested to use the address location information to tag an entrance. Unfortunately the data is not consistent enough to do this.</div>



<div><br></div><div>## Recommendation</div></blockquote></div><br>Option 2 makes more sense for routing. The router software positions you to the entrance. OSM can have a distinct advantage if we can route better. However, you should first verify that the data actually is located at the building entrance. If only a small percentage is correct, it may not be the best choice. </div>

<div class="gmail_extra"><br></div><div class="gmail_extra">We still need help with editors when deleting nodes. When a node contains both an amenity and address information, the editors delete both when just the amenity needs deleting. Addresses don't change all that often. Placing addresses on the building polygon helps because buildings typically last longer than amenities. <br>

<br clear="all"><div><br></div>-- <br><div>Clifford</div><div><br></div><div>OpenStreetMap: Maps with a human touch</div>
</div></div>